2003 House Bill 4225

House Roll Call 666: Passed

To reduce the minimum age requirements for obtaining a hunting license from 12 years of age, to 11 years of age if the hunter turns 12 years of age at anytime during the calendar year in which license is issued. This would also be the minumum age for a license to hunt deer, bear, or elk with a firearm, which under current law is 14 years of age. A minor would still need to be accompanied by a parent or guardian in the field.

69 Yeas / 33 Nays
Republican (60 Yeas / 0 Nays)
Democrat (9 Yeas / 33 Nays)
Excused or Not Voting (8)
